Transware's vulnerability footprint centers on its Active Mail product family, a niche messaging and collaboration platform with particular relevance to legacy enterprise deployments. The recurring vulnerability classes reflect the application's web-facing and message-handling architecture, clustering around input-validation issues including cross-site scripting and code injection, alongside instances of improper information exposure.
